Context Bookmarks, a Chrome extension, adds the bookmarks to the context menu when you right-click on any empty space on the web page. After installing the extension, when you right-click, you'll be able to see a new menu called “Bookmarks bar,” and from there, you can view an entire list of your bookmarks.
